What is photosynthesis?

Back

Photosynthesis is the process by which green plants, algae, and some bacteria convert light energy into chemical energy in the form of glucose, using carbon dioxide and water, and releasing oxygen as a byproduct.

What is cellular respiration?

Back

Cellular respiration is the process by which cells convert glucose and oxygen into energy (ATP), carbon dioxide, and water.

What role does sunlight play in photosynthesis?

Back

Sunlight provides the energy needed for plants to convert carbon dioxide and water into glucose and oxygen during photosynthesis.

How does deforestation affect the carbon cycle?

Back

Deforestation increases the level of carbon dioxide in the atmosphere because fewer trees are available to absorb CO2 during photosynthesis.

What is the relationship between photosynthesis and cellular respiration?

Back

Photosynthesis produces glucose and oxygen, which are used in cellular respiration to produce energy, carbon dioxide, and water.
